Ultrasorbs Extra Strength Drypad and Drawpad is placed underneath a patient who will be stationary for prolonged periods of time. It's ideal to use in the operating room, emergency room and in labor and delivery. The Ultrasorbs Disposable Drypads, manufactured by Medline, have an absorbent polymer material to give an ultra absorbency layer to manage moisture and protect the patient's skin. This eliminates the need of adding additional sheets which keeps costs down. It's also tear resistant with Medline's LiftSupport backsheet technology. Should the patient need to be repositioned or lifted to be transferred, the low profile pad will hold up to patients up to 375 pounds. The drawpad is also air permeable to keep patient's skin comfortable and not build up heat. Vitality Medical also offers Ultrasorbs AP Underpads.

Medline Underpads Comparison Chart
In the comparison chart below, the Ultrasorb ES is highlighted in red in the last column. This product has two size variations and is designed for patients with a high risk of adverse skin conditions. It offers maximum absorbency and may be used as an overnight underpad. Caregivers may reposition or lift patients up to 375 pounds using this durable underpad-drawpad.
